Joseph Duggar's Whereabouts Unknown as Officials Decline to Comment 3 Days After His Release From Arkansas Jail
Key Points:
- Joseph Duggar was released from custody in Arkansas on March 27 after waiving his right to extradition to Florida, where he faces two felony counts of lewd and lascivious behavior related to allegations of sexually abusing a 9-year-old girl during a 2020 family vacation.
- The Bay County Sheriff's Office in Florida has not confirmed if Joseph is currently in their custody, and formal charges have yet to be filed by prosecutors in that jurisdiction.
- Joseph and his wife Kendra Duggar are also facing unrelated misdemeanor charges in Arkansas for false imprisonment and endangering the welfare of a child, with Kendra out on bail and both scheduled for an April 29 court appearance.
- Joseph, known for his appearances on the Duggar family’s TLC reality series, has been married to Kendra since 2017 and is a father of four; the family’s show was canceled in 2021 following the conviction of his older brother Josh Duggar on child pornography charges.
